As some of you may already know, chess consists of 3 main stages: the Opening, the Middlegame, and the Endgame. in order to be a good chess player, you should maximize your abilities in all three of these areas. We will begin by discussing what the opening is, and tips on how you can successfully navigate through this stage of the game.

The opening are the starting moves of a chess game. It usually transitions into the middle game around move 10-15. The main things you should remember when playing an opening is to prioritize piece development, king safety, and control of the center.
